Abstract:It summarizes the earthquake disaster information and main characteristics of mainland China by compiling a catalog of earthquakes of magnitude 5.0 (or above) in 2023. Combining information such as the earthquake disaster assessment reports of the seismological bureaus of the relevant provinces (autonomous regions and municipalities directly under the central government), the results of earthquake disaster losses and the characteristics in typical earthquake cases are listed. By comprehensively comparing the historical earthquake disaster data in mainland China over the past 20 years and analyzing the interannual changes in the frequency of earthquakes and the number of casualties, it is concluded that the earthquake disaster losses in China in 2023 are heavier and more concentrated, with housing damages, inappropriate evacuation of people, and secondary geologic hazards being the main reasons for the casualties.
